I did some more work with Instant Meshes program. It appears the -align to boundaries- button helps to get the output quads where you want them. This is especially helpful when you want to -copy/flip/attach- later in A:M. Attached are two pictures and a short .MOV that I made with an imported .OBJ of a spaceman. I can see that the models are not pretty, but because they are small and smooth, you can get useful results. The whole process of importing an .OBJ into Instant Meshes, outputting the reconfigured .OBJ and importing it into A:M only takes a minute or two. The pictures show the original .OBJ on the left and the Instant Meshes version on the right. …

This is a little try at making an AO style render with just z-buffered kleig lights. I chose the "Biobot" character from the extras disk because he has lots of crevices and bumps to challenge the occlusion effect. AOBTurnTestH.mov The result isn't quite as satisfying as a real AO image but it takes only 5 seconds per frame to render. The quicktime compression is making the shadows on the ground look patchier than they really are. In the original render they're quite smooth.

Has anyone got an idea on why my mushroom is banded like this? I have an animated decal (QT movie) as a displacement map but it hasn't got THAT much compression in it. And look at the underside of the "crown;" it's like a surface break... The surface it pretty hi-res; a 40X40 patch grid rolled into a tube. I'm working of this tutorial and Weevil doesn't run into any of this... hash.com/users/weevil/ EDIT : Part of it turned out to be a poorly-compressed transparency decal. But there's still more going on in this image. ANy ideas? Rhett
